All Packages This Package Class Hierarchy Class Search Index
Class grendel.widgets.DefaultHeaderRenderer
java.lang.Object | +----java.awt.Component | +----java.awt.Container | +----com.sun.java.swing.JComponent | +----grendel.widgets.DefaultHeaderRenderer
The default renderer for column headers. Handles text headers and not much else. Aspires to handle icons.
public class DefaultHeaderRenderer
extends com.sun.java.swing.JComponent
implements grendel.widgets.HeaderRenderer
{
// Fields 5
Column fColumn;
Border fEmptyBorder;
Border fLoweredBorder;
Border fRaisedBorder;
int fState;
// Constructors 1
public DefaultHeaderRenderer();
// Methods 6
public Component getComponent();
public Dimension getMaximumSize();
public Dimension getMinimumSize();
public Dimension getPreferredSize();
public void paint(Graphics);
public void setValue(Column, int);
}
Fields
fColumn
Column fColumn
fState
int fState
fRaisedBorder
Border fRaisedBorder
fLoweredBorder
Border fLoweredBorder
fEmptyBorder
Border fEmptyBorder
Constructors
DefaultHeaderRenderer
public DefaultHeaderRenderer()
Methods
setValue
public void setValue(Column aColumn, int aState)
- Implements:
- setValue in interface HeaderRenderer
getComponent
public Component getComponent()
- Implements:
- getComponent in interface HeaderRenderer
getPreferredSize
public Dimension getPreferredSize()
- Overrides:
- getPreferredSize in class JComponent
getMinimumSize
public Dimension getMinimumSize()
- Overrides:
- getMinimumSize in class JComponent
getMaximumSize
public Dimension getMaximumSize()
- Overrides:
- getMaximumSize in class JComponent
paint
public void paint(Graphics g)
- Overrides:
- paint in class JComponent
All Packages This Package Class Hierarchy Class Search IndexFreshly brewed Java API Documentation automatically generated with polardoc Version 1.0.4